What you get with this Offer
I will design and implement a high availability configuration for your Linux application infrastructure — covering HAProxy or Nginx load balancer setup, Keepalived for virtual IP failover between active and standby load balancers, database replication (MySQL/MariaDB master-replica or Galera cluster), shared storage configuration (NFS or GlusterFS), and health check monitoring ensuring automatic failover when a node becomes unavailable. Single points of failure in production infrastructure are acceptable risks during early-stage development; they become unacceptable liabilities the moment your application has paying customers who expect consistent availability.
The implementation covers a two-node load balancer pair with Keepalived managing the virtual IP, HAProxy configuration with health checks for all backend application nodes, SSL termination at the load balancer layer, application server pool with session affinity configuration, database replication setup and failover procedure documentation, and a planned failover test confirming the configuration switches traffic correctly within your acceptable failover time. A runbook covering routine maintenance, node replacement, and emergency failover procedures is included.
Designed for businesses running applications that have outgrown single-server deployments and need a cost-effective high availability architecture on Linux VPS or dedicated hardware without the complexity and cost of full cloud-managed Kubernetes.
